Comprehending Mobility ScootersWhat is a Mobility Scooter?
A mobility scooter is a motorized vehicle designed to assist individuals with mobility obstacles. These scooters are geared up with a seat, a guiding mechanism, and a battery-powered motor. They are particularly beneficial for people who have trouble strolling fars away or representing extended durations.
Types of Mobility ScootersThree-Wheel Scooters: These are more maneuverable and appropriate for indoor use. They are normally lighter and simpler to transport.Four-Wheel Scooters: These offer much better stability and are ideal for outside use, particularly on uneven surface areas.Travel Scooters: Designed for portability, these scooters can be disassembled for easy transport and storage.Heavy-Duty Scooters: Built to support users with greater weight capacities, these scooters are robust and long lasting.Aspects to Consider When Choosing a Mobility Scooter1. User Needs and LifestyleIndoor vs. Outdoor Use: Determine where you will mostly use the scooter. Indoor scooters are smaller sized and more maneuverable, while outside scooters are developed for rougher surface.Weight Capacity: Ensure the scooter can support your weight comfortably. Sturdy scooters can support up to 500 pounds or more.Variety and Speed: Consider how far and how fast you require to take a trip. Some scooters have a variety of approximately 30 miles on a single charge.2. Convenience and ErgonomicsSeat and Backrest: Look for a comfortable, adjustable seat with excellent back support. Some scooters use reclining seats for included convenience.Steering and Controls: The controls must be easy to use and available. Some scooters have ergonomic deals with and intuitive control panels.Suspension: A great suspension system can make a significant difference in convenience, particularly on rough surfaces.3. Maintenance and DurabilityBattery Life: Opt for a scooter with a long-lasting battery and a fast charging time. Lithium-ion batteries are generally more efficient and have a longer life expectancy.Guarantee and Customer Support: Choose a brand name that provides a comprehensive warranty and reliable client assistance.4. Cost and ValueBudget: Mobility scooters can range from a couple of hundred to numerous thousand dollars. Set a spending plan and try to find a scooter that offers the very best value for your cash.Extra Features: Consider functions like lights, baskets, and Bluetooth connection, which can boost your experience.Top 5 Best Mobility Scooters1. Are mobility scooters covered by insurance?Answer: Some insurance plans, including Medicare, may cover mobility scooters under specific conditions. It's important to contact your insurance supplier to comprehend the coverage and any associated costs.2. How do I keep a mobility scooter?Response: Regular upkeep is vital for the durability of your scooter. This includes:Battery Maintenance: Keep the battery charged and clean the terminals.Tire Pressure: Check and adjust tire pressure regularly.Cleaning: Wipe down the scooter to keep it tidy and devoid of particles.Lubrication: Lubricate moving parts as recommended by the manufacturer.3. Nevertheless, three-wheel scooters are typically better for indoor use due to their smaller size and better maneuverability, while four-wheel scooters are better for outside use due to their stability and toughness.4. What is the optimum weight capability for a mobility scooter?Response: The maximum weight capability for a mobility scooter can vary, but durable designs can support up to 500 pounds or more. It's important to pick a scooter that can conveniently support your weight.5. How do I transport a mobility scooter?Response: Some mobility scooters are developed to be dismantled for much easier transport. You can also consider acquiring a scooter lift or ramp for your car. Furthermore, some makers offer specialized transport choices for their scooters.
